All of the statements about Roosevelt’s group of advisers (known as the "brain trust") are true EXCEPT the members
BaLLatris [955]

Answer:

Option b

Explanation:

  • Brain trust started as a term for a gathering of close guides to a political competitor or officeholder, prized for their ability in specific fields.  
  • Brain trust helped to build up a financial arrangement whose projects turned into the foundation of the New Deal: guideline of bank and stock action, enormous scale alleviation, and open work programs for individuals living in both urban and country zones.  
  • Moley, a teacher of government and law who enrolled the gathering, contended that a backward expense (a level tax all natives pay: deals imposes, a level duty on explicit measure of pay, and so on.) was the best way to revamp the economy.  
  • Tugwell molded a significant part of the organization's rural arrangement, accepting that the way to facilitating a portion of the downturn's hardships lay in the capacity of the government to address the developing unevenness among wages and costs.
  • Notwithstanding, Berle dismissed the possibility of an arranged economy, yet recommended "another financial protected request" that would incorporate a bigger government job in the adjusting of the economy.  
  • During their initial one hundred days of work in office, the Brains Trust helped FDR sanction fifteen significant laws. One of the most significant activities was the Banking Act of 1933, which put the financial frenzy to a halt.  
  • After the Brains Trust guarded its change recuperation program in 1933, it disbanded to prepare for different consultants and legal counselors equipped for authoritative draftsmanship.
